Description:
Reception and management of municipal waste from inhabited and mixed properties in the territory of the City of Jasła between 01.07.2022 and 31.12.2022.

The object of the order is: receiving municipal waste from the owners of inhabited and mixed properties (properties in part used as inhabited properties and in part as uninhabited properties (e.g. business activities, public facilities, etc.) ) from Jasła city site and the development of received waste, i.e. recovery or disposal, in a way that ensures adequate levels of recycling, preparation for reuse and recovery by other methods and reducing the mass of biodegradable municipal waste transmitted for storage referred to in the Act of 13 September 1996 on the maintenance of cleanliness and order in municipalities (Journal of Laws of 2021, item 888 as amended) hereinafter referred to as the Maintenance of Purity and Order in Municipalities.

Waste management should comply with the applicable provisions, in particular with the Act of 14 December 2012 on Waste (Journal of Laws of 2021, item 779 as amended) hereinafter referred to as the Waste Act, the Law on Maintenance of Purity and Order in Municipalities and the Waste Management Plan for Subcarpathian Voivodeship, hereinafter referred to as WPGO. Waste management should be consistent with the hierarchy of ways to deal with waste. Received unsegregated (mixed) municipal waste should be transferred directly to municipal installations.

Waste should only be collected from inhabited and mixed properties.

The estimated amount of municipal waste to be received from the city of Jasła during the whole period of completion of the order will be approximately 5442.00 Mg (tonnes), including:

unsegregated (mixed) municipal waste and municipal waste segregation residues (code 200301) of approximately 3360,00 Mg (tonnes);

selectively collected municipal waste type: plastics/metals/multi-cartridges in quantity of approximately: 600,00 Mg (tonnes);

selectively collected municipal waste paper type in an amount of approximately: 108,00 Mg (tonnes)

selectively collected municipal waste glass type in an amount of approximately: 132,00 Mg (tonnes);

biodegradable waste (green waste code 200201) in a quantity of approximately: 816,00 Mg (tonnes);

large waste and consumed electrical and electronic equipment (code 200307) of approximately 396,00 Mg (tonnes);

worn tyres (code 160103): 12,00 Mg (tonnes);

construction and demolition waste (code 170107) in a quantity of approximately: 12,00 Mg (tonnes);

biodegradable kitchen waste (code 200108) in quantity approximately: 6,00 Mg (tonnes), where selective reception of such waste is introduced.

The estimated amount of properties covered by the municipal waste management system is c. 5013, including properties inhabited c. 4633, and mixed approx. 380. The population covered by the municipal waste management system is 25972.
